Police Release CCTV Images Following Assault at Bursledon Tesco Extra

Police have released CCTV images of a man they wish to speak to in connection with an assault at Tesco Extra on Hamble Lane in Bursledon.

The incident occurred at approximately 5.35pm on Friday, 15 August. A man in his 40s was reportedly pushed into a set of milk cages by an unknown male inside the store. The victim sustained bruising as a result of the assault.

Hampshire & Isle of Wight Constabulary are appealing for help to identify a man captured on CCTV who may have information that could assist their investigation.

The man is described as:
• Tanned
• Aged in his 50s
• Approximately 6ft tall
• Of very large build
• Bald with stubble
• Wearing a white polo shirt and brown shorts at the time of the incident
